Title: ●Standard for Presentation of Nucleotide and Amino Acid Sequence Listings Using XML in Patent Applications to Implement WIPO Standard ST.26; Incorporation by Reference | |
Abstract:
The United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) is adding to the rules of practice for submitting biotechnology data associated with disclosures of amino acids and nucleotides in patent applications to comply with the new international standard adopted by the World Intellectual Property Organization. Patent applications that contain disclosures of nucleotides and/or amino acids must present the associated biological sequence data in a standardized electronic format (a Sequence Listing) as a separate part of the disclosure. Under the new rules, a single internationally acceptable Sequence Listing will be presented in a language neutral format using specified International Nucleotide Sequence Database Collaboration (INSDC) identifiers rather than the numeric identifiers previously used. These new rules will ensure that a Sequence Listing submitted in an original application filed on or after January 1, 2022, complies with the international standard. Unlike the previous standard, no separate paper Sequence Listing or portable document file (PDF) submission of a Sequence Listing will be permitted. Any Sequence Listing that exceeds the USPTO patent electronic filing system limits may be submitted on physical media. |

Overall Description of Deadline: The standardized electronic format for applications filed in the United States and internationally on or after January 1, 2022, must conform to the WIPO standard for sequence listings, Standard ST.26, which requires sequence listings to be submitted in XML format. |
